Taxonomic Classification

Rank Giant Mole Shrew Marsh Button
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Arthropoda (Arthropods)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Insecta (Insects)
Order Soricomorpha (Soricomorpha)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ths)
Family Soricidae Tortricidae
Genus Anourosorex Acleris
Species Anourosorex schmidi Acleris lorquiniana

Evolutionary Relationship

Giant Mole Shrew and Marsh Button share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
